Investing for the Long Term in a Volatile Market

Investing for the long term can be challenging, especially when market shifts are high. It's common to get caught up in the day-to-day movements, but remember that true wealth accumulation comes from a strategic approach. Instead of responding impulsively to market information, focus on your long-term aspirations.

Construct a diversified portfolio that allocates your investments across different asset classes, such as equities, bonds, and real estate. This helps to minimize risk and stabilize returns over time.

Remember that patience is key when it comes to long-term investing. There will be periods of expansion and regression, but by staying the course and sticking to your plan, you can maximize your chances of realizing your financial aspirations.

Superannuation Simplified: Understanding Your Retirement Savings Plan

Planning for retirement can seem daunting, but understanding your superannuation plan is a great place to start. It's essentially a long-term savings account that grows over time thanks to contributions from both you and your workplace. Your super funds are invested in a variety of assets like shares, bonds, and property, aiming to maximize your future income.

  • Take a look at your super statement to track your balance.
  • Know what you're paying associated with your super fund, as these can eat into your returns over time.
  • Look around for a better deal if you think your current fund isn't a good fit.

By getting to grips with superannuation, you can take control of your financial future and set yourself up for a comfortable retirement.
